Industrial Manufacturing/Emerging Technologies Advanced Certificate (Major Code 6992C)


Return to {$returnto_text} Return to: Transfer Guides and Programs

Offered at the Levelland Campus and the SPC Reese Center

The Advanced Industrial Manufacturing/Emerging Technologies Certificate is designed to be a continuation of the manufacturing technology curriculum, which prepares graduates with increased knowledge and skills targeting higher productivity within the manufacturing profession. Students choose from one of five of Specialty Career Tracks, which include semiconductor/electronics specialization, machinist specialization, network communications specialization, mechatronics specialization and alternative energy specialization.  Completion of the Industrial Manufacturing/Emerging Technologies Certificate of Proficiency is a prerequisite to enrollment in the Advanced Certificate program.

This is a TSI-waived certificate. Student who declare this major are not subject to TSI regulations unless they enroll in a course outside the prescribed curriculum.
